Top Importers of Vinyl Polymers

The top importers of vinyl polymers in 2023 were dominated by China, leading with imports valued at $405.1 million, followed by Germany and the United States at $350.41 million and $304.93 million, respectively. Belgium and India also showed significant import values, indicating strong demand for vinyl polymers in industrial applications. Italy, France, and Mexico rounded out the higher tier of importers, with each country importing over $170 million. Notably, emerging markets such as India have demonstrated a considerable year-on-year growth rate, while established markets like the United States and Germany have experienced steadier trends.
